Cubans Residents in Belize celebrate Their VI Nacional GatheringBELIZE, December 17, 2009.- With an attendance of over 50 Cuban residents in Belize, the Association of Cuban Residents celebrated their VI National Event. Present also were the Ambassador and Consul of Cuba to Belize.

During a few hours the attendants debated issues of importance for the Association and passed a Final Statement were among other topics, reflected their support in the struggle against the US Blockade to Cuba, claimed freedom for the Cuban Five and decided to name the organization after Commander Ernesto Che Guevara.Cubans Residents in Belize celebrate Their VI Nacional Gathering

Present also in the gathering were family and children of the Cuban residents who developed a separate program. They also enjoyed the documentary Ode to the Revolution and the cultural activity had the performance of a saxophonist and a singer.

The organization has emerged strengthened and with the commitment of substantially increasing their activities in 2010. (Cubaminrex-Embacuba Belice)
